Theater building
The Wolverhampton , commonly known as The Grand, is a theatre located on Lichfield Street, . The theatre was designed in 1894 by Architect Charles J. Phipps. It is a Grade II Listed Building with a seating capacity of 1200. is situated 500 feet southeast of Hog’s Head.
